MILAN (Reuters) -Italy reported 27 coronavirus-connected deaths on Sunday, down from 46 the previous day, the fitness ministry referred to, while the every day tally of new infections fell to 2,278 from 2,748.
Italy has registered 131,301 deaths linked to COVID-19 given that the outbreak in February ultimate year. It has the 2d optimum toll in Europe in the back of Britain and the ninth highest on the earth. The nation has reported four.7 million circumstances to this point.
sufferers in medical institution with COVID-19 - no longer including those in intensive care - stood at 2,651 on Sunday, down from 2,692 a day prior.
there were 13 new admissions to intensive care instruments, reducing from 16 on Saturday. the whole number of sufferers in intensive care with COVID-19 fell to 364 from a previous 367.
Some 270,044 checks for COVID-19 were conducted during the past day, in comparison with a previous 344,969, the health ministry spoke of.
